Travel Delays In Two Areas Of Calaveras County

San Andreas, CA – Motorists face travel delays as work gets underway near two communities in Calaveras County for a road rehabilitation project in the Butte Fire area.

The Calaveras County Department of Public Works will be removing and replacing damaged culverts prior to the upcoming Butte Fire Road Rehabilitation – Repaving Project. That work will run through early August. There will be one-way traffic with flaggers to allow for culvert installation on several county-maintained roads near the communities of Mountain Ranch and Railroad Flat.

The work is being done between 7 a.m. and 4 p.m. weekdays. Public works listed these culvert repair/replacements locations listed:
